Another important aspect of military drones is their use as target drones. These drones are designed to simulate enemy aircraft or missiles, providing valuable training opportunities for military personnel. Target drones such as the Aofun UAV are designed to mimic the speed, flight patterns, and radar signatures of real threats, allowing armed forces to test their weapon systems and tactics in realistic scenarios.

In addition to their role in training exercises, military drones are also used for surveillance and reconnaissance missions. Equipped with high-definition cameras, infrared sensors, and other advanced technologies, drones can gather valuable information about enemy positions, movements, and activities. This real-time data allows military commanders to make informed decisions and respond quickly to emerging threats.

Military drones have also been deployed in combat situations, carrying out precision strikes against enemy targets with unparalleled accuracy. Armed with missiles, bombs, and other weapons, drones can neutralize high-value targets while minimizing the risk to military personnel. This capability has proven to be highly effective in modern warfare, allowing armed forces to conduct surgical strikes and protect civilian populations from harm.

The use of military drones has fundamentally changed the dynamics of modern warfare by providing real-time intelligence, surveillance, and reconnaissance capabilities to military commanders. Drones can cover vast areas of terrain and provide high-resolution imagery and data that are crucial for decision-making on the battlefield. This enhanced situational awareness allows commanders to quickly assess threats, monitor enemy movements, and respond effectively to changing situations.

Moreover, military drones have proven to be a cost-effective and efficient alternative to traditional manned aircraft for various missions. Drones can be deployed quickly and operated remotely, reducing the risk to military personnel and minimizing the logistical footprint required for operations. The precision strike capabilities of military drones have also been demonstrated in targeted operations against high-value targets, minimizing collateral damage and civilian casualties.

However, the proliferation of military drones has raised ethical and legal concerns regarding issues such as civilian casualties, privacy violations, and the potential for autonomous weapons systems. The use of drones in targeted killings and assassinations has sparked controversy and debate over the ethical implications of unmanned combat and the role of human judgment in military decision-making.
